This dropped waist, ruffled dress looks great in size 3T - Size 6. For older girls, it could easily be designed as a top to wear with denims or shorts.

Fabric Requirements

Because I don’t know what size dress you want to make, I’ve decided to eliminate the math and ask you to bring the following fabric:

 

♦    Select good quality, woven cotton fabric. It will shrink less and be easier to sew.

♦    If you want both ruffled layers to be made from the same fabric, bring one yard of fabric.

♦    If you want make the ruffles from two different fabrics, bring a half yard of each fabric.


Ribbon

I purchased ribbon in two different widths. I sewed the narrower width ribbon to the dress to cover the seam joining the t-shirt and the skirt. The wider ribbon, I tied into a bow and stitched to the dress.

To Do Before Class

□    Wash, dry and press the fabric.

□    Square one end of the fabric.

□    Cut a 4" strip across the width of fabric for testing ruffler settings. If you are using two different fabrics, cut this strip from the fabric you intend to use for the upper ruffle.

□    Hang the fabric from a clip hanger and bring to class.
